What is a remote radiology technologist?

A Remote Radiology Technologist operates medical imaging equipment, such as X-ray or MRI machines, from a remote location to assist healthcare providers in diagnosing patients. They may guide on-site personnel, review imaging results, and ensure high-quality scans while following safety protocols. This role often requires strong technical skills, experience in radiologic technology, and the ability to work independently. Remote technologists typically collaborate with radiologists and healthcare teams via digital platforms.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a remote radiology technologist?

To thrive as a Remote Radiology Technologist, you need a solid background in radiologic technology, medical imaging procedures, and an active ARRT certification or equivalent state licensure. Experience with Picture Archiving and Communication Systems (PACS), digital imaging tools, and telehealth platforms is essential. Attention to detail, strong communication skills, and the ability to work independently in a virtual environment make candidates stand out. These abilities ensure accurate imaging, timely reporting, effective remote collaboration, and compliance with healthcare regulations.

What are some common challenges remote radiology technologists face when working from home?

A key challenge for Remote Radiology Technologists is maintaining high image quality and accuracy while troubleshooting technical issues independently. You’ll need to communicate effectively with on-site healthcare teams to ensure that imaging protocols are followed and patient care standards are met. Staying organized, keeping up with workflow demands, and ensuring data security are essential in a remote role. However, most employers provide comprehensive training, technical support, and networking opportunities to help you succeed. Working remotely also allows for more flexibility and can support a better work-life balance for many professionals.
